In this new podcast series by AAHA Press, Marsha Heinke, author of Practice Made Perfect: A Complete Guide to Veterinary Practice Management, discusses common pain points her clients face. One big issue deals with marketing, both to current clients and prospective clients and where and how you should focus your time.

In the fourth and final episode in this podcast series, Marsha discusses the difference between internal and external marketing, how to update your website to attract new clients, and how to use social media to communicate.

Dr. Marsha Heinke (Ohio State University CVM 1979) is a certified public accountant, enrolled agent, and certified veterinary practice manager. Her firm’s team works exclusively with veterinary professionals seeking to improve business systems and quality of care. The firm provides a wide breadth of management consulting services, business valuation, group facilitation, speaking and writing, back-office assistance, tax and accounting services.
